##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 10.19: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A pass
- On black (#000000): 2.06:1 — AA fail, AA-large fail,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#af50aa (4.55:1); AA: background → #adadad (4.54:1); AAA: text → #c47ec0 (7.09:1); AAA: background → #d6d6d6 (7.01:1)
